Fishing Bokeelia

Out of all the areas I serve, Bokeelia feels the most remote and unspoiled. This is Charlotte Harbor country, where the water opens up and the fishing becomes more about covering water and finding scattered fish. The harbor itself is massive and relatively shallow, with productive grass flats that hold redfish and spotted seatrout throughout the year. What I appreciate as a captain is the variety of structure available, from the deep spoil islands to the oyster beds that line the mangrove shores. Bokeelia also provides the best access to the outer islands and the Gulf when conditions allow, giving us options that some of the more protected areas lack. The fishing here is less about finesse and more about locating fish, which often means running and polling the flats until we find active feeding zones. It is a different pace than the canal fishing around Cape Coral, and clients who want a more adventurous charter often prefer this area.

Fishing Bokeelia FAQ

How far is Bokeelia from Pine Island?
Bokeelia is on the northern tip of Pine Island, about a 20-minute drive from my home base.
What is the best season for Bokeelia fishing?
Fall through spring offers the most consistent action, with summer being productive but hotter.
Can I catch big fish in Bokeelia?
The harbor holds some larger redfish and snook, though the area is known more for consistent action than record sizes.
